  • Title

    Development of automatic control system for supplying cold water based on PLC and configuration software

  • Abstract
    In order to supply cold water for engine laboratory PLC, configuration software, HMI, and inverter are adopted to construct an automatic control system in this paper. The control system is a distributed control system, which has higher dependability and maintainability. The reading and writing network instructions are utilized to solve the communication among multi-master problem. The remote monitoring software is developed with configuration software. By measuring temperature and pressure of entrance and exit pipes, refrigeration equipments and water pumps are adjusted real-time to guarantee to supply stable temperature and pressure cold water. Therefore the quality of water is improved and power is saved. Practice proves that the system designed meets user´s requirement. The system has a good reliability and high degree of automation.
